| 5/11/26 | ![]() Scaling a Biotech Business: Lessons on Pivoting & Growth from Affinity Immuno | Amir describes a non-linear path into science, switching from social sciences after rediscovering biology and finding organic chemistry intuitive and creative. She explains her PhD work at the University of Calgary in carbohydrate chemistry, synthesizing tumor-associated carbohydrates to support vaccine and detection research. | 1/9/25 | ![]() From Bruises to Battles: Kaitlyn's Quest to Afford Healthcare | Breakthroughs in medicine are useless unless patients can access them. In this episode of the PATHWAYS IN LIFE SCIENCE podcast, Kaitlyn Sai shares her harrowing journey of being diagnosed with ITP, a condition where the immune system destroys its own platelets. After traditional treatments failed and she ended up in the emergency room with life-threatening bleeding, her doctor prescribed a game-changing drug called Eltrombopag (Promacta). The catch?
